James L Brooks is an American filmmaker, television producer, and screenwriter whose work spans decades and genres. This overview presents structured details about his career, milestones, and creative impact.
Below is a concise profile table that highlights key identifiers, roles, and professional markers associated with James L Brooks.
| Field | Details | Significance | Reference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Full Name | James Lawrence Brooks | Used on official credits and interviews | Primary sources, biographies |
| Born | May 9, 1940 | North Bergen, New Jersey, United States | Public records |
| Primary Roles | Director, writer, producer | Shaped narrative and tone across film and television | Industry databases |
| Notable Works | Taxi, Broadcast News, Terms of Endearment, As Good as It Gets | Define his range from comedy to drama | Filmographies, studio archives |
| Major Awards | Oscars, Emmys, Golden Globes | Recognition for writing and directing excellence | Award databases, ceremony records |
Early Television Career and Formative Years
James L Brooks began in television during the 1970s, contributing scripts and shaping humor for influential series. His work on Taxi established his reputation for sharp, character driven comedy. These years laid the groundwork for his later success in both sitcoms and serious drama.
Breakthrough in Feature Films and Storytelling
Moving to film, James L Brooks directed and wrote movies that balanced emotional depth with accessible storytelling. Broadcast News and Terms of Endearment demonstrated his ability to blend humor with poignant themes, earning widespread critical acclaim.
